The difference between hay and haylage is based on the way in which that each is manufactured. Hay is grass that's Lower, left to dry, and turned to make sure that moisture degrees are around ten–15%. This can be accomplished so that the chance of mould increasing is minimised when stored, enabling for greater preservation.

In preparing for the next cold and wet period, It is usually doable to re-watertight your meadow blanket immediately after washing. In use, textiles with drinking water-repellent Attributes deteriorate more quickly. The water-repellent treatment method layer step by step disappears. Notice that Repeated washing will quickly additional change the water-resistant properties of the fabric. It really is thus sensible that ahead of reusing these blankets At first with the period, you utilize a layer of Particular website waterproofing product or service for blankets.
Huge meals are tough to digest and may contribute to the event of difficulties like colic. No horse ought to be acquiring over 0.5 % of its physique weight in grain-centered concentrates all through one feeding.
As herbivores, horses require a forage-dependent diet because they extract Strength primarily from fermenting fiber of their huge intestine (hindgut). You must normally prioritize hay or grass and make it the majority of your respective horse’s nourishment.
